The market for vehicles with significant mileage is growing, particularly in the UK. Data from the DVSA shows that over 309 Teslas have surpassed 200,000 miles, with 5,300+ exceeding 100,000 miles. One standout example is a Tesla Model S that has clocked an impressive 697,744 miles, challenging common myths about battery longevity.

Why Consider Selling Your High-Mileage EV?
Selling a vehicle with substantial mileage can be a strategic decision. For older Teslas, particularly those built before 2017, there’s a unique appeal. These models often come with transferable free Supercharging perks, identified by the SC01 code. This feature can save buyers over £500 a year on charging costs, making them highly desirable in the used car market.
Another factor to consider is the warranty. Tesla’s battery warranty typically covers 8 years or between 100,000 to 150,000 miles. As your vehicle approaches these milestones, it’s worth evaluating its value. Elon Musk has claimed that Tesla batteries can last between 300,000 to 500,000 miles, but real-world data suggests this varies. Selling before the warranty expires can be a smart move.

Understanding Battery Health in High-Mileage EVs
Battery health is a critical factor when evaluating vehicles with substantial use. Real-world examples, like the Tesla Model S with 697,744 miles, debunk myths about battery longevity. This data shows that modern tech ensures durability even after years of use.
Professional buyers use advanced test protocols to assess battery health. These include measuring capacity and analysing charging patterns. Tesla’s battery warranty guarantees 70% capacity retention, but real-world degradation often stays well above this threshold.
To preserve battery health before selling, follow expert advice. Limit charging to 80% and avoid frequent rapid charges. These simple steps can extend your battery’s lifespan and maintain its value.

High-Mileage Teslas: A Case Study
Tesla models with extensive mileage offer unique insights into long-term performance and value retention. The Model S, for instance, dominates high-mileage statistics, with over 4,000 units surpassing 100,000 miles. This is largely due to its popularity in taxi and private hire fleets, where reliability and range are crucial.
When comparing degradation rates across models, the Model S and Model 3 show minimal capacity loss, even after years of use. Fleet vehicles, often subjected to frequent Supercharging, still maintain strong battery health. This data highlights the durability of Tesla’s technology.
Supercharging plays a significant role in fleet operations. While rapid charging can impact battery longevity, Tesla’s advanced cooling systems mitigate this effect. This ensures that even high-use vehicles retain their value over time.
